## Releases

Heads up for security review: SockPatch 1.9 fixes the reconnect bug where the Tidegate client would retry with a stale session token after a dropped websocket, occasionally resuming someone else's stream. Nasty, now fixed — reconnects mint fresh tokens and the old path is gone. All release binaries are signed in CI; please verify the 1.9 artifacts against the key we publish here.

signing key of bagap-yawep = bky13_TbfT6ZMUoGJo2

## Formula sandbox tuning

User-supplied formulas in Gridmoor execute inside a restricted interpreter with hard ceilings on time, memory, and call depth. Reviewers should confirm any change to these ceilings is justified in the PR description, since raising them widens the abuse surface. Defaults were chosen from production traces. The current limits are as follows.

limits module of tafog-fawip:
WEIGHTS = {
    "julix": 57,
    "lamys": 992,
    "kasvan": 209,
    "quenok": 750,
    "alddor": 259,
    "oliath": 1009,
    "wenix": 815,
}

Handing off the Veltrano tax-rate lookup cache before I'm out next week. It refreshes from the Bramlett rates feed every six hours; if the feed is stale, it serves the last snapshot and logs a warning, which is fine for up to two days. Evictions are size-based, nothing fancy. If the hit ratio drops below 80%, just restart the warmer job. Everything the cache needs at boot is listed in the values below.

deployment values, kajep-kageg:
[praix]
host = praix.paliqcorp.corp
user = praix_svc
database = praix_prod